This is the first official photo of Infiniti’s new Q80 Inspiration Concept, which the automaker says, will “lead to a future” four-door fastback model in the luxury segment.

“After showing Q30 Concept and Q50 Eau Rouge, Infiniti is eager to show the upper range of our portfolio expansion,” said Infiniti Executive Design Director, Alfonso Albaisa. “In Q80 Inspiration, we wanted to capture that unforgettable feeling when you experience something important, something beautiful, something magnetic for the first time.”

At 5,052 millimeters (198.9 inches) with a long wheelbase of 3,103 mm (122.2 in), a width of 2,027 mm (79.8 in) and height of 1,350 mm (53.1 in), the Q80 is slightly longer and wider than the Mercedes-Benz CLS and BMW 6-Series Gran Coupe, which along with the Porsche Panamera and Audi A7 Sportback, should be its main rivals.

Infiniti says the concepts can accommodate “four occupants in a highly stylized and personalized ambiance of the highest quality. Carbon fiber, aluminum and leather surround those inside in spacious ‘1 + 1 + 1 + 1’ seating”. We’re guessing the +1 seat is for children.

The outer skin of the low-slung sports saloon is full of curves and creases looking a lot like a four-door version of the 2009 Infiniti Essence concept supercar.

No other details or photos were shared today, but we will see Infiniti’s new concept in the flesh in about a week’s time at the 2014 Paris Motor Show.
